1. The Prescription Process
Unlike in some nations where pharmacists can recommend a large variety of medications, most medications in the USA require a prescription from a certified health care supplier (such as a physician, nurse professional, or dentist). The supplier will normally send this prescription digitally directly to the patient's selected pharmacy.
2. Insurance coverage and Copays
Most Americans utilize medical insurance to assist cover the cost of medications. When choosing up a prescription, the client generally pays a copay (a repaired amount) or coinsurance, depending on their insurance plan's formulary (the list of covered drugs).

3. Automatic Refills and Mobile Apps
Significant USA drugstores have accepted digital innovation. Clients can download mobile apps to track their prescriptions, set medication tip alarms, request automatic refills, and receive text alerts when their medications are ready for pickup.
Beyond Medications: The Rise of Retail Clinics
One of the most substantial modifications in the USA drugstore industry over the previous twenty years is the introduction of retail health care clinics. Chains like CVS (MinuteClinic) now home walk-in clinics staffed by nurse professionals and doctor assistants.
These clinics bridge the space between medical care doctors and emergency clinic. Clients can stroll in or schedule same-day consultations for:
- Common illnesses (strep throat, ear infections, sinus infections)
- Minor injuries (sprains, small cuts, small burns)
- Physical exams (sports, camp, and school physicals)
- Vaccinations (flu, pneumonia, shingles, and travel vaccines)
This design provides incredible benefit, permitting clients to seek advice from a clinician and choose up their recommended medication all under one roofing system.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)Can I walk into a USA drugstore and buy antibiotics without a prescription?
No. In the United States, antibiotics and most other effective medications strictly need a prescription composed by a certified medical professional.
Do USA pharmacies accept international medical insurance?
Generally, significant USA pharmacies do not directly expense global medical insurance companies. Are USA pharmacies open 24 hours?
While not every location is open around the clock, major nationwide chains like CVS and Walgreens typically maintain select 24-hour places in significant city areas for emergency prescription needs and basic shopping.

How do I move a prescription from one drugstore to another?
Transferring a prescription is normally basic. You can bring your current prescription bottle or invoice to the brand-new drug store, or call the new pharmacy and supply them with your old pharmacy's information, prescription number, and medication name. They will handle the transfer process for you.
